@Fishy: The problem being that there is no difference between what you say and what I say. By acknowledging that my stance is considered to be pro-town you are also acknowledging that by arguing it I appear pro-town. You are then following that up with the statement that I am scum because of it. The Too Townie fallacy covers cases where a person is suspected because their arguments are supposedly contrived with the purpose of appearing pro-town, which is another way of saying that the person in question is acting pro-town so they must be scum.

Also please note that as either alignment my goal is to get my opponents lynched, not to look overly pro-town. As town I'd much rather lynch scum and get painted as scummy because of it than prevent my own lynch, and as scum getting my target lynched is top priority, even if I have to take heat to do it.

Kairyuu wrote:@Fishy: The problem being that there is no difference between what you say and what I say. By acknowledging that my stance is considered to be pro-town you are also acknowledging that by arguing it I appear pro-town.
Absolutely not. I think that policy lynches are generally considered antitown, and opposing them protown. However, here, it doesn't feel like you are opposing the idea for in-game reasons, but just for the sake of looking protown. Thus I think you are scum trying (and failing) to look protown.

Kairyuu wrote:The Too Townie fallacy covers cases where a person is suspected because their arguments are supposedly contrived with the purpose of appearing pro-town, which is another way of saying that the person in question is acting pro-town so they must be scum.
I don't know if this is true in the common usage, but it's flat out wrong. If someone doesn't drop any scumtells, that makes them more likely protown. But if I know that someone is deliberately going out of their way to avoid dropping scumtells, I think they are probably more likely scum.
I don't think your arguments are contrived to look protown because they look so protown; they look contrived. The TT fallacy is a red herring here.
